2012-08-14

初回起動時のセットアップ画面を表示

移行アシスタント.appでは、同じアカウント名に復元データを上書きできないことに気がついた間抜けな自分のための、Macを出荷時の(アカウントが作成されていない)状態に戻す方法。購入直後にMacを起動したときに表示されるセットアップ画面を再現させる。

シングルユーザーモードで起動(command + S)し、次の手順を実行。

$ launchctl load /System/Library/LaunchDaemons/com.apple.opendirectoryd.plist
$ dscl . -list /Users
$ dscl . -delete /Users/<accountname>
$ rm -r /Users/<accountname>
$ rm /var/db/.AppleSetupDone

<accountname>の部分は削除したいユーザーのアカウント名。dsclコマンドの-listで確認しておく。